Kantana Film and Animation Institute, Thailand

Kantana Film and Animation Institute, Thailand

Kantana Film and Animation Institute, Thailand College Development design by Bangkok Project Studio + Boonserm Premthada: massive eight-metre-high handmade brick walls with undulating geometric profiles characterise this undergraduate college.
